Identifying Frequent Technical Glitches Disrupting User Experience
Recognizing Connectivity Interruptions and Their Causes
Connectivity issues are among the most common hindrances faced by online casino users. These disruptions can manifest as game freezes, sudden disconnections, or unresponsive interfaces. Causes include unstable internet connections, server overloads, or network configurations that restrict data flow. For example, during peak hours, server congestion can lead to increased latency, causing disconnections. Research indicates that over 30% of user complaints in online casinos relate to connectivity problems, emphasizing the importance of stable infrastructure.
Diagnosing Payment Processing Failures
Payment failures, whether during deposits or withdrawals, undermine player trust and platform credibility. Causes range from insufficient funds, incorrect payment details, to issues with third-party payment gateways like e-wallets or bank processors. Occasionally, security protocols may flag transactions as suspicious, blocking legitimate payments. For example, a common failure occurs when a user’s bank blocks an overseas transaction, necessitating communication between the casino and banking institution to resolve the issue.
Addressing Game Loading and Rendering Issues
Slow or failed game loading can be attributed to outdated software, browser incompatibilities, or server-side delays. Rendering issues might cause graphics to appear incorrectly or gameplay features to malfunction. For instance, a blackjack game not loading properly on certain browsers could be due to incompatible WebGL settings. Ensuring that games are optimized for various devices and browsers helps reduce such errors.
Practical Methods for Resolving Login and Authentication Failures
Resetting Passwords and Managing Account Security
Many login issues stem from forgotten passwords or security restrictions. Providing a straightforward password reset process—via email or SMS—is essential. Implementing multi-layered security measures, such as CAPTCHA or account lockouts after multiple failed attempts, enhances security while maintaining accessibility. For example, allowing users to verify their identities through biometric data or security questions can streamline recovery and deter unauthorized access.
Handling Two-Factor Authentication Errors
Two-factor authentication (2FA) adds a security layer but can sometimes prevent login if users misconfigure or lose access to authentication apps. Common solutions include offering backup codes, enabling alternative verification methods, or allowing temporary bypasses for verified users. A typical scenario involves a user losing their mobile device; platform support teams can assist by verifying identity and disabling 2FA temporarily, ensuring continued access.
Overcoming Browser Compatibility and Session Timeouts
Browser incompatibilities may cause login failures or session expirations. Encouraging users to update browsers or use recommended ones maximizes compatibility. Session timeouts, set for security reasons, can be managed by extending timeout periods for trusted devices. For example, implementing persistent login options for frequent players improves user experience without compromising security.
Optimizing Platform Performance to Minimize Error Incidents
Implementing Server Load Balancing Strategies
Server overloads lead to slow responses or crashes. Load balancing distributes user requests across multiple servers, preventing single points of failure. Large online casino operators employ cloud-based solutions to dynamically allocate resources during high traffic, reducing downtime. For instance, during major sporting events, effective load balancing ensures seamless gameplay for thousands of concurrent users.
Streamlining Software Updates and Patch Management
Frequent updates are vital for security and functionality but can introduce bugs if not managed properly. Adopting continuous integration and deployment (CI/CD) pipelines allows for thorough testing before release. Regular patching fixes known issues, enhancing stability. For example, rolling out a casino’s new software version after comprehensive regression testing minimizes post-update errors.
Enhancing Mobile Responsiveness for Seamless Play
With increasing mobile usage, ensuring platforms adapt smoothly across devices prevents errors like interface misalignments or unresponsive buttons. Responsive web design, combined with mobile-specific optimizations, enables players to enjoy uninterrupted experiences on smartphones and tablets. Studies show that over 60% of online casino traffic now originates from mobile devices, underscoring the significance of mobile-first development.
Detecting and Preventing Cheating or Fraudulent Activities
Monitoring Unusual Betting Patterns
Anomalous betting behaviors—such as rapid bets, high stake fluctuations, or improbable win/loss sequences—often indicate collusion or fraud. Implementing real-time analytics allows platforms to flag suspicious activity promptly. For example, detecting multiple accounts acting in coordination can help prevent potential cheating schemes.
Using AI Tools for Real-Time Suspicion Detection
Artificial intelligence enables casinos to analyze vast transaction data streams rapidly, identifying patterns inconsistent with typical player behavior. AI models can adapt over time, learning new fraud tactics. Studies demonstrate that AI-based monitoring reduces false positives and improves detection accuracy, safeguarding both platform integrity and fair play.
Strengthening User Verification Processes
Enhanced Know Your Customer (KYC) protocols, including document verification and biometric scans, are critical for preventing identity theft and underage gambling. Regular audits, combined with automated verification tools, help ensure that users are genuine, further reducing the risk of fraudulent activities.
Evaluating Impact of Recent Software Updates on Error Occurrence
Tracking Post-Update Bug Reports and Fixes
Implementing comprehensive bug tracking systems enables casinos to monitor issues identified after updates. Collecting user feedback and analyzing error logs allows developers to prioritize fixes. For instance, a recent update might introduce new bugs that cause game crashes, highlighting the need for swift patches.
Conducting Regression Testing Before Deployment
Regression testing ensures new code does not adversely affect existing functionalities. Automated testing suites simulate user interactions across different devices and browsers to catch potential errors early. This process minimizes post-deployment error rates and enhances platform stability.
Gathering Feedback for Continuous Improvement
Engaging users via surveys and feedback forms provides insights into issues that may have been overlooked during testing. Continuous improvement cycles, based on real-world user experiences, help refine software quality.
